Deep Dive into Evaluation Areas

Sales Performance and Proactivity

At REVOLVE, passive service is not enough. Interviewers look for evidence that you take initiative to greet customers, offer styling advice, and suggest complementary items to increase the average order value.

Be ready to go over:

  • Your history of meeting or exceeding sales targets.
  • Techniques you use to initiate conversations with cold leads.
  • How you handle "no" and pivot to find a different solution for the customer.

Example questions or scenarios:

  • "If a customer is looking at a specific dress, what other items would you bring them to complete the look?"
  • "How do you handle a slow period on the floor?"

Culture and Brand Fit

You are not just selling clothes; you are selling an experience. Interviewers assess whether your personality matches the high-energy, trend-conscious nature of the team.

Be ready to go over:

  • Your genuine interest in current fashion trends.
  • How you contribute to a positive, collaborative team environment.
  • Your ability to represent the brand's values in your personal and professional conduct.

Example questions or scenarios:

  • "What do you think is the biggest challenge for a brand like REVOLVE in the current retail market?"
  • "How do you stay updated on new arrivals and brand campaigns?"

Key Responsibilities

As an Account Executive, your day-to-day is a mix of high-touch service and operational maintenance. You are expected to manage the client experience from the moment they walk through the doors, ensuring they feel welcomed and styled according to their needs. This involves deep product knowledge; you must be able to navigate the inventory to find the right sizes, fits, and styles that flatter the client.

Beyond direct sales, you are responsible for maintaining the visual integrity of the store. This includes merchandising, ensuring the floor is tidy, and keeping the presentation consistent with the REVOLVE brand guidelines. Collaboration with your fellow associates is vital, as the store environment requires a seamless hand-off of customers and shared responsibility for store-wide goals.

Role Requirements & Qualifications

A strong candidate for this role possesses a blend of retail experience and high-level social intelligence. While specific sales experience is highly valued, the ability to learn the REVOLVE product catalog and adopt the brand voice is non-negotiable.

  • Must-have skills: Exceptional communication, high energy, professional presentation, and a baseline understanding of sales techniques.
  • Nice-to-have skills: Prior experience in luxury or contemporary fashion retail, proficiency with retail POS systems, and a strong personal social media presence that aligns with fashion trends.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How long does the hiring process usually take? The process is often fast, sometimes concluding within a week or two, especially for roles in high-traffic locations. Because the team often interviews candidates who visit the store, you may find the timeline is compressed compared to corporate roles.

Q: Is there a specific "look" I should have for the interview? REVOLVE is a fashion-forward company. You should dress in a way that is professional but stylish and reflective of the current trends you would see on the site.

Q: How should I prepare if I have never worked in furniture or high-end retail? Focus on your transferable skills: customer service, ability to learn fast, and your passion for the brand. Highlight any experience where you had to influence a decision or manage a client relationship.

Q: What is the most important thing to show in the interview? Confidence and a "can-do" attitude. The team wants to see someone who is not afraid to approach customers and who is genuinely excited about the products.

Other General Tips

  • Research the location: Different store locations may have slightly different vibes; try to visit the specific store you are applying to beforehand to understand their current floor focus.
  • Show, don't just tell: If you have a passion for fashion, talk about specific pieces you love from the current collection to show you have done your homework.
  • Be ready for on-the-spot engagement: If you are visiting a store to drop off a resume, treat every interaction with staff as a potential interview.
